[发明专利]一种数字电视机顶盒基于分区名的USB升级方法有效
申请号: | 201110262123.9 | 申请日: | 2011-09-06 |
公开(公告)号: | CN102385520A | 公开(公告)日: | 2012-03-21 |
发明(设计)人: | 刘海润 | 申请(专利权)人: | 四川金网通电子科技有限公司 |
主分类号: | G06F9/445 | 分类号: | G06F9/445;H04N21/43 |
代理公司: | 四川省成都市天策商标专利事务所 51213 | 代理人: | 刘兴亮 |
地址: | 610000 四川省成*** | 国省代码: | 四川;51 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 数字电视 机顶盒 基于 分区 usb 升级 方法 | ||
1.一种数字电视机顶盒基于分区名的USB升级方法,其特征在于:包括制作升级文件系统和进行USB升级;
所述的制作升级文件系统包括以下步骤:
1.1 制作升级文件;
1.2 制作升级配置文件;
1.3 加密配置文件;
所述进行USB升级包括以下步骤:
2.1 系统启动及初始化;
2.2 判断是否有USB盘新插入,若是则进入2.3步骤,若不是则继续监控;
2.3 判断是否有升级配置文件,若是则进入2.4步骤,若不是则进入2.2;
2.4 解密升级配置文件;
2.5 解析升级配置文件并保存关键信息到内存中;
2.6 判断是否满足升级要求,若是则进入2.7步骤,若不是则进入2.2;
2.7 保存关键信息到数字电视机顶盒的可掉电保存的存储器中;
2.8 系统重启;
2.9 把USB中升级文件写入到数字电视机顶盒中的保存程序的存储器中;
2.10 修改数字电视机顶盒的版本信息;
2.11 系统退出。
2.根据权利要求1所述的一种数字电视机顶盒基于分区名的USB升级方法,其特征在于:所述的步骤1.1中所述制作升级文件包括根据欲升级内容所在分区,打包分区内容,并命名成数字电视机顶盒中该分区的名字,一个分区制作一个文件,每个文件名与数字电视机顶盒中该分区的名字相同。
3.根据权利要求1所述的一种数字电视机顶盒基于分区名的USB升级方法,其特征在于:所述的步骤1.2中制作升级配置文件包括把升级厂家信息、升级文件、升级文件版本信息、升级文件校验信息写入到配置文件中。
4.根据权利要求1所述的一种数字电视机顶盒基于分区名的USB升级方法,其特征在于:所述的步骤2.2是系统中有一任务在监控USB盘状态,若有USB新盘插入,USB状态会变为有新的USB盘插入。
5.根据权利要求1所述的一种数字电视机顶盒基于分区名的USB升级方法,其特征在于:所述的步骤2.3包括解析USB盘中的文件系统,并根据配置文件名来判断是否存在该文件。
6.根据权利要求1所述的一种数字电视机顶盒基于分区名的USB升级方法,其特征在于:所述的步骤2.4包括根据加密算法所需要的解密算法来解密配置文件以还原未加密的配置文件。
7.根据权利要求1所述的一种数字电视机顶盒基于分区名的USB升级方法,其特征在于:所述的步骤2.5包括根据配置文件的格式来得到配置关键信息,包括厂家信息,升级文件名、升级文件版本信息、升级文件校验信息,并保存在内存中。
8.根据权利要求1所述的一种数字电视机顶盒基于分区名的USB升级方法,其特征在于:所述的步骤2.6包括根据数字电视机顶盒中原来保存的USB升级关键信息和现有的来进行对比,只有当厂家信息一致,版本信息比原来更高,校验信息和实际计算的一致,才满足升级条件,并把现有升级的关键信息保存,以供升级时使用。
9.根据权利要求1所述的一种数字电视机顶盒基于分区名的USB升级方法,其特征在于:所述的步骤2.9包括从USB中读出升级文件名,并把文件写入到与该文件名一致的分区中。
10.根据权利要求1所述的一种数字电视机顶盒基于分区名的USB升级方法,其特征在于:所述的步骤2.10包括把数字电视机顶盒的最新版本信息更新,以保证分区文件与其版本信息一致。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于四川金网通电子科技有限公司,未经四川金网通电子科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201110262123.9/1.html,转载请声明来源钻瓜专利网。